Jurors weigh fate of driver who killed 2 Oakton High School students in 2022 crash
VIENNA, Va. - Jurors will enter a second round of deliberations over a recommended punishment for a Virginia man convicted of hitting and killing two teenage girls. Usman Shahid, now 20, has been convicted of two counts of involuntary manslaughter after hitting and killing 15-year-old Leeyan Yan and 14-year-old Ada Nolasco in June 2022.
7 suspects arrested for Fairfax burglary, potentially linked to cross county burglaries: police
FAIRFAX COUNTY, Va. - Police have arrested seven out-of-state suspects, possibly linked to other burglaries across the country. Fairfax County police responded to the 6000 block of Columbia Pike in Lake Barcroft for a report of a burglary on April 21, around 9 p.m. Police say home surveillance cameras captured multiple suspects entering the home at the listed address. The suspects stole jewelry, handbags, and a safe.
